Skip to content

Commit 9233de3

Browse files
authored
Merge pull request #2917 from dotty-staging/fix-order-implicits
Fix the order of implicit context bound parameters
2 parents 592f267 + 13362e3 commit 9233de3

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

compiler/src/dotty/tools/dotc/ast/Desugar.scala

+1-1
Original file line numberDiff line numberDiff line change
@@ -222,7 +222,7 @@ object desugar {
222222
case evidenceParams =>
223223
val vparamss1 = meth.vparamss.reverse match {
224224
case (vparams @ (vparam :: _)) :: rvparamss if vparam.mods is Implicit =>
225-
((vparams ++ evidenceParams) :: rvparamss).reverse
225+
((evidenceParams ++ vparams) :: rvparamss).reverse
226226
case _ =>
227227
meth.vparamss :+ evidenceParams
228228
}

0 commit comments

Comments
 (0)